(PSN)NearlyDedicated Posted September 8, 2014 Share Posted September 8, 2014 Yeah, as the others have said, it's just bc Venus hasn't gotten its own tileset yet. A long time ago, it was the only Corpus tileset alongside the ship one. So for all corpus planets, the ice world was the tileset. This is changing over time, however.
